Johnson & Johnson Coated Vicryl Suture (J844G)
The Coated Vicryl Suture (J844G) is an absorbable, sterile surgical suture composed of polyglactin 910, a synthetic braided material coated for smooth tissue passage. It features a PC-3 3/8 circle reverse cutting needle, designed for precision in general soft tissue approximation and ligation.
Key Features:
- Absorbable: Gradually breaks down in the body via hydrolysis, typically retaining strength for 50–60 days.
- Coated for Smooth Handling: Reduces tissue drag and improves knot security.
- Braided Construction: Enhances tensile strength and handling characteristics.
- Precision Needle: Reverse cutting needle (PC-3) with a 3/8 circle curvature for controlled suturing.
Specifications:
- Material: Polyglactin 910 (coated)
- Needle Type: PC-3 (3/8 circle, reverse cutting)
- Size: 5-0 (USP)
- Length: 18 inches
- Absorption Profile: Complete within 56–70 days
- Sterile: Ethylene oxide sterilized
Suggested Use:
Ideal for subcutaneous and intradermal closures in general surgery, gynecology, and other soft tissue applications where prolonged wound support is unnecessary. Suitable for areas requiring minimal scarring and where suture removal is impractical.
